This will be a partial re-boot of the Fairy Tail roleplay, "These Lost In Starlight." In the year x987, Fiore continues to prosper as the magic capital of the world. Its guilds remain the primary business for magical services in a world of wonder, adventure, and mystery. However, dark threats remain looming, ready to be unleashed upon the unsuspecting world. A new generation of mages has been born, and their journey has only just begun. Will they uphold the world's peace and become legends, or will their world crumble to pieces around them?




The story will pick up exactly one month after the final events of the previous arc. The mother, leader of the Dark Guild "Echidna", launched a war against the guilds of Fiore, nearly destroying Fairy Tail, Raven Tail, and Sabertooth before they were finally overcome by the combined forces of the legal guilds. Now the country is in a state of rebuilding as the survivors begin picking up the pieces.

With the threat of Echidna finally behind them, the inhabitants of Fiore can breathe easily again. But how long will it be, until a new peril arises?

In the wake of Echidna's battle, the dark guilds have realized the weakness of the legal guilds. Taking advantage of this golden opportunity, was one band of renegades in particular, the members of the Raccoon Alliance. They are a group of thieves united by one goal: making the most money they can off stolen goods. More specifically, the supply and transfer of ancient heirlooms, guild treasures, and magical artifacts.
Port_Town.jpg


Out to the most western edge of Fiore, sat the small town of Pinnacle; it's convenient location set on the precipice of a triangular trade route to various other islands and countries, made it a prime target for Dark Guilds looking to make a quick buck. It was here that the Raccoon alliance wanted to set-up their base of operations. However, for the past few years, there was always something plaguing their plans to successfully infiltrate the town: the sheriff of the area, A'den Kandosii.


A friend to neither dark guilds nor legal ones, sheriff Kandosii has single-handedly kept the port free from both. As a feared and respected S-class wizard excelling in the arts of re-quip and guns magic, he is truly a force to be reckoned with. So much so, that even the magic council thinks twice before trying to meddle in his affairs. With extreme physical strength and an unrivaled arsenal of magical weapons, he is thought to be one of the most powerful wizards in the world.


To understand where the Sheriff's intense dislike for guilds comes from, one has to understand the history of Pinnacle itself. Originally, the town was a large port city, the dominant and undisputed trading center of the region. All that changed when a war broke out between the Raccoon Seeker alliance of the past, versus the Magic Council and Legal Guilds of the day. The foreign legions of Raccoon Seeker sought the ancient relics of old, important to their master, and eventually learned that the most valuable of these items were in the hands of a treasure hunter residing in Pinnacle, A'den's father.


When the preparations were finally complete, the alliance converged on the port city on the premise of establishing a base of command and stealing wealth. Unfortunately, the Magic Council saw this maneuver too late, and could not gather their Rune Knight armies in time to deter the invasion. Out of desperation, they recruited all available guilds and nearby Rune Knights to fight in the First Battle of Pinnacle. Thousands of lives were lost in the ensuing carnage, annihilating an entire portion of the city and land to create what is now known as Oblivion Bay. Sadly, among those killed was A'den's father, leaving the young man to care for his mother and younger sister. Pinnacle and A'den were both scarred and deeply wounded by the raging battle. Vengeance, guilt, and loneliness drove him to become strong enough to protect his family and town from future threats-- chief among them, guilds and mages.


He was taken under the wing of the previous sheriff and trained in the ways of magic. Years later, when the older sheriff passed away, he gave A'den a treasure left by the boy's father: a magical key of unknown purpose. Eventually, it was passed on to his sister, for both safekeeping and as a prized memory of their deceased father.


The sheriff's growing reputation for kicking the ass of any guild member that dared approach Pinnacle, spread out far enough that the port quickly became a neutral zone, free from the influence of dark guilds and the Magic Council alike.


But now the dark guilds are at it again. Over the past few months, they have been infiltrating the small city of 100,000, shadily cutting deals in the street, recruiting henchman, and building up their base of operations behind the scenes.
